Mashed Potatoes

Get ready to make the easiest mashed potatoes ever! This simple recipe uses just a few ingredients. The potatoes are boiled until tender, then mashed with butter and milk to create a creamy, fluffy texture. You can easily customize this recipe with your favorite add-ins like garlic or cheese.

Equipment

  • Stovetop
  • Large Stovetop Pot
  • Potato Masher

Ingredients

  • 1 pound Potatoes
  • 1 teaspoon Butter
  • ¼ cup Milk Low-fat
  • Salt To taste
  • Ground Black Pepper To taste

Instructions

  • Cut potatoes in half. Place in large stovetop pot, cover with cold water and bring to a boil.
  • Reduce heat to a gentle boil and cook until potatoes are tender.
  • When potatoes are tender, drain and mash the potatoes with a fork or a potato masher.
  • Stir in butter, salt, pepper, and milk. Return to low heat and stir until warm if needed.
